バックアップからのトランザクションレプリケーションの初期化


10

レプリケーションのパブリケーションを設定するときに、バックアップからの初期化を許可するオプションがあります。私たちは数年前から複製データベースを作成しており、常にバックアップから初期化してきましたが、このフラグを設定したことはありません(数日前に初めて気づきました)。複製は常に問題なく機能してきました。

これを使用する必要があることを説明するヒットがたくさん見つかりましたが、理由を説明するものはありません。

これが実際に何をしているのか誰かが理解していますか?私の観点から、それは必要ではないようですが、私は何かを逃している必要があると考えています。


パブリケーションでピアツーピアが有効になっていますか(たとえそれを使用していない場合でも)。その場合、バックアップからの初期化設定trueは、指定されていない場合でもデフォルトで設定されます。msdn.microsoft.com/en-us/library/ms188738.aspx
Jon Seigel 2012

ストレート一方向トランザクションレプリケーションを使用しており、フラグがfalseに設定されていることを確認しました。今後はtrueに設定しますが、その目的を理解したいと思います。
PseudoToad 2012

1
バックアップを使用して初期化する」の動作とタイトルが付けられたreplicationanswers.com/NoSyncOn2005.aspの下から3番目のセクション、および落とし穴を回避する方法
crummel4

1
ステップバイステップのインストラクションについては、を参照してください。データベースのバックアップを使用して初期化SQL Serverレプリケーションまた、REPLTalkは上の良い記事がありトランザクションレプリケーションのバックアップからの初期のディープダイブ
キンシャー

回答:


4

質問に回答済みのマークを付けることができるように、コメントを回答に入れます。

@ crummel4は、「http://replicationanswers.com/NoSyncOn2005.aspの下から3番目のセクションを参照してください。「バックアップを使用して初期化する」の動作と、落とし穴を回避する方法」

@Kin氏は、「段階的な手順については、http: //www.mssqltips.com/sqlservertip/2386/initialize-sql-server-replication-using-a-database-backup/ またはhttp:// blogsを参照してください。.msdn.com / b / repltalk / archive / 2010/03/16 / deep-dive-on-initialize-from-backup-for-transactional-replication.aspx

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.